The Texas Longhorns host the Virginia Cavaliers tonight at 9:15 p.m. ET in an ACC vs. SEC showdown. This is the first matchup between these two programs since December 2018, and it’s tied 1-1. Texas is 6-2 this season and is coming off its best victory of the season against NC State. Virginia is 6-1, with its lone defeat against Butler.

Texas is the favorite in this matchup at -2.5 with Virginia being a +136 underdog on DraftKings Sportsbook. Here is my best bet for tonight’s Virginia vs. Texas matchup.

Virginia vs. Texas (9:15 p.m. ET)

Although Virginia is No. 39 via KenPom, it has the 25th-best offensive rating. Virginia is averaging 87.6 points per game, with four players in double figures each night. Freshman Thijs De Ridder leads the team in scoring with 18 points while shooting 44.4 percent on three-pointers. The Cavaliers have a deep backcourt with veterans Malik Thomas, Sam Lewis, Jacari White, and freshman Chance Mallory.

Texas is led by Dailyn Swain (16.5) and Matas Vokietaitis (15.5) this season on offense. The Longhorns have displayed an elite offense this year, but have been inconsistent at times. They also have a ton of talented guards with Swain, Jordan Popen, and Mark Tramon. Virginia vs. Texas is an elite matchup of guards, but Virginia has the game’s best overall player in De Ridder.

Texas recently beat NC State but lost to the previous two teams it has faced from a major conference. Virginia is 2-1 against the three high-level opponents it has faced. The Cavaliers were held to 73 points by Butler, but they shouldn’t have as many issues against Texas, which has the 65th-best defensive rating.
